Hardleaf Asparagus (Asparagus Striatus) is a perennial shrub in the Asparagaceae family with easy care difficulty. It requires low watering and full sun or partial shade light in USDA hardiness zones 9-11. This plant is safe for cats and dogs.

Asparagus striatus is a rigid, erect perennial shrublet native to dry, rocky areas of South Africa.
